Conversion formula

The conversion factor from cubic inches to deciliters is 0.163870640693, which means that 1 cubic inch is equal to 0.163870640693 deciliters:

1 in3 = 0.163870640693 dL

To convert 265.7 cubic inches into deciliters we have to multiply 265.7 by the conversion factor in order to get the volume amount from cubic inches to deciliters. We can also form a simple proportion to calculate the result:

1 in3 → 0.163870640693 dL

265.7 in3 → V(dL)

Solve the above proportion to obtain the volume V in deciliters:

V(dL) = 265.7 in3 × 0.163870640693 dL

V(dL) = 43.54042923213 dL

The final result is:

265.7 in3 → 43.54042923213 dL

We conclude that 265.7 cubic inches is equivalent to 43.54042923213 deciliters:

265.7 cubic inches = 43.54042923213 deciliters
